CHEG 6500 - Chemical Process Design and Analysis I A project-oriented course tailored to the interests of the students that covers concepts and principles of chemical process design and analysis, optimization, capital estimation, and cost analysis. Discusses the time value of money and other economic measurement parameters, the profit motive, and making engineering knowledge-based recommendations. Computer simulation, written and oral communication intensive. Completion of a major project report is required.
Prerequisites/Corequisites: Prerequisites: CHEG 4600 and CHEG 4870; or instructor approval.
Credits: 3 hours
Notes: Open to graduate students only.
